    The company was registered as Thomas Ross Ltd in 1920 in Grimsby. In 1929, Carl Ross became chairman and managing director when his father retired. By the outbreak of World War II, Thomas Ross Ltd operated fish merchanting branches in Leeds, Leicester, and Fleetwood as well as its Grimsbybase.

    Starting with a small fleet of four fishing vessels in the 1930s, Ross diversified into trawling from 1934. The acquisition of a major shareholding in Trawlers Grimsby in 1944 was followed by several other fishing fleets such as the Queen Steam Fishing Company.     By the early 1960s, Ross's holdings included poultry, frozen and fresh foods, including fish, as well as its fish trawling, merchanting, and other operations.     Carl Ross left the Ross Group after an acrimonious board room struggle in 1965 and, as a direct result of this, Imperial Tobacco gained control in September 1969; the company had offered £47.5 million for Ross on 6 August 1969.
